Convenience

Electric fireplaces are an easy way to add ambiance and heat to your home without the fuss of gas lines or messy wood. Electric fireplaces don't generate flames, but instead use LED lights in combination with video to create the illusion of fire. Because of this, they do not produce the extreme heat of gas or wood-burning fire places and don't pose a danger to flammable mantel wall or ledges.

Most models look very like traditional fireplaces equipped with a mantel and surround. They are designed to sit placed flush against the wall and have a built in heater that can heat up a room. Some have a flat-panel that can hold the widescreen TV. Some also have a shelf to display decorations or media. Some have a remote control that allows you to control the flames and heater from anywhere in the home.

Some models can be permanently erected in your home, while others are portable. You can personalize the model to suit your preferences by selecting the surround and mantel colors. Many models have a practical timer that stops overheating and an automatic shut-off that can be set to bedtime.

A lot of these fireplaces have a variety of settings to ensure that they are not too hot. This makes them a good option for homes with small pets or children because the temperature is simple to regulate. They also don't require the use of a chimney, meaning they can be used in rooms with delicate furniture.

Safety

When properly used, an electric fireplace that is stand-alone is a safe alternative to other sources of heat supplemental. They do not release harmful or hazardous emissions and do not require a chimney sweep. They're also easier to troubleshoot when something goes wrong since there is no actual fire burning.

As with other appliances in your home, it's important to follow the instructions of the manufacturer for safe use. This includes not putting anything that is flammable around the appliance and Electric Fireplace Stand Alone keeping it out of liquids. Also, don't connect the fireplace to an electrical outlet and avoid putting any objects on top of the unit when it's turned on.

Some models can be freestanding, while others need to be mounted on the wall. If you choose to go with the latter, choose an area where the unit isn't frequently bumped against or will not come into contact with flammable blankets or other items. It's important to keep the area around it clean to ensure that it doesn't result in an accidental touch.

Most of these units heat the air inside your home with either infrared or fan-driven heating technology. The former is good to quickly heat large rooms while the latter can heat smaller spaces with more accuracy.
